While its function appears simple, the integrity of this small bolt is paramount to the engine's health, as a single failure can lead to a catastrophic loss of oil and subsequent engine damage. Design and Material Composition Typically manufactured from hardened steel or alloy steel, the oil pan bolt is engineered to withstand significant stress.
It is considered best practice to replace the bolt with a new one whenever the oil pan is removed for repairs, rather than reusing a fastener that has been stressed. Exposure to high temperatures, engine cleaning chemicals, and constant vibration can cause the metal to fatigue, stretch, or corrode.
